Investment Firm Republic Buys Stake in Crypto Broker-Dealer INX at $50M Valuation

New York-based INX (INXDF), a digital asset broker-deal has received a $5.25 million investment from investment firm Republic, with an option for a full buyout later this year.
Republic will acquire around a 9.5% stake in INX at an approximate $50 million pre-money valuation, with a "non-binding" commitment to acquire of 100% of equity at a valuation of $120 million as early as third quarter of this year. The closing of the initial deal is expected to be within 60 days, subject to regulatory approval.
The goal of the two firms is to "expand the breadth and depth of tokenization infrastructure and access to digital assets for investors worldwide," according to an emailed announcement on Monday.
Also headquartered in New York, Republic is a digital merchant bank operating retail-focused investment platforms, backed by Galaxy Interactive and Morgan Stanley among others. The integration of INX's digital asset coverage into Republic's platforms could therefore present a major expansion in crypto trading capabilities on offer to a large traditional finance client base.
"By integrating INX's digital trading infrastructure for financial markets with Republic's expertise in primary distribution, we are redefining the way capital is raised and empowering both institutional and retail investors globally," said Kendrick Nguyen, CEO of Republic in the statement.

Protocol Research: GoPlus Security

What to know:
- As of October 2025, GoPlus has generated $4.7M in total revenue across its product lines. The GoPlus App is the primary revenue driver, contributing $2.5M (approx. 53%), followed by the SafeToken Protocol at $1.7M.
- GoPlus Intelligence's Token Security API averaged 717 million monthly calls year-to-date in 2025 , with a peak of nearly 1 billion calls in February 2025. Total blockchain-level requests, including transaction simulations, averaged an additional 350 million per month.
- Since its January 2025 launch , the $GPS token has registered over $5B in total spot volume and $10B in derivatives volume in 2025. Monthly spot volume peaked in March 2025 at over $1.1B , while derivatives volume peaked the same month at over $4B.

French Banking Giant BPCE to Roll Out Crypto Trading for 2M Retail Clients

What to know:
- French banking group BPCE will start offering crypto trading services to 2 million retail customers through its Banque Populaire and Caisse d’Épargne apps, with plans to expand to 12 million customers by 2026.
- The service will allow customers to buy and sell BTC, ETH, SOL, and USDC through a separate digital asset account managed by Hexarq, with a €2.99 monthly fee and 1.5% transaction commission.
- The move follows similar initiatives by other European banks, such as BBVA, Santander, and Raiffeisen Bank, which have already started offering crypto trading services to their customers.
